Resume

Yang Xiaohong received Ph.D. from the College of Pharmacy, Chongqing University in June 2019 and then she has been working at the Chongqing Institute of Green and Intelligent Technology, Chinese Academy of Sciences. Her research focuses on the development of novel anti-resistance drugs based on natural products, application research of engineered exosomes in anti-infectious disease treatment, and development of new technologies for precise exosome detection. She has led multiple research projects, including National Natural Science Foundation of China (NSFC) Youth Program, Chongqing Natural Science Foundation General Program and two enterprise collaborative projects. She has published over 30 SCI-indexed papers in journals such as Angewandte Chemie, Journal of Medicinal Chemistry, and Journal of Controlled Release (first/co-first author: 14 papers).
